Description

This publication showcases the multidimensional benefits of neglected and underutilized species and their potential contribution to achieving Zero Hunger, highlighting the challenges and opportunities for harnessing these lesser-known food crops. It also provides strategic recommendations to create an enabling environment for the promotion, production, marketing and consumption of these food varieties to foster healthier diets

Author Biography:

Founded in 1945, the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) leads international efforts to defeat hunger. Serving both developed and developing countries, FAO provides a neutral forum where all nations meet as equals to negotiate agreements and debate policy. The Organization publishes authoritative publications on agriculture, fisheries, forestry and nutrition.
